Php Built In Web Server Https

But you can also simply run php-server and the server will already be available at httplocalhost8080. The standard Python library has a built-in module that can be used as minimalistic HTTPHTTPS web server.

Nginx And Php Fastcgi On Ubuntu Https Library Linode Com Web Servers Nginx Php Fastcgi Ubuntu 10 04 Lucid Web Server Interface Server

Using this command a simple Web Server will run and listen to a port 8000.

Php built in web server https. You can specify any port. All the project files are served on the built-in server with the root URL httplocalhost with respect to the project structure. When it comes to web development most people wouldnt doubt PHPs best friend is Apache HTTPD Server.

How to Start a PHP Built-in Web Server. It does not accept requests or send responses over the stream wrappers. Serve static HTMLCSS files to outside world can be very helpful and handy in many real life situations.

In this field type the name of the host the PHP built-in web server runs on. Now you can write and test your code without having to have a. The openssl extension and function support is unrelated.

The built-in web server is meant to be run in a controlled environment. Symfony provides a web server built on top of this PHP server to simplify your local setup. The only thing new about it is support for multiple workers to make it faster for concurrent request handling.

The built-in web-server itself was released with PHP 54 2012. This is useful if you need to run tests on a local website and less overkill than making Apache point at the workspace root. PHP Built-in Web Server Jenkins plugin A plugin to run a PHP built-in web server for each build.

Read:  Amazon Cloud Hosting Price Calculator

The php-server command can receive some parameters and they are. URI requests are served from the current working directory where PHP was started unless the -t option is used to specify an explicit document root. You can create a php-serverini file to leave the settings of each project already pre-established.

Your web server must be configured for HTTPS which means you need a SSL server certificate. Apple computers already have PHP installed but if youre on Windows or Linux you may need to run a PHP installer The PHP built-in server is used to aid in writing PHP scripts without having to run a full stack web server. The built-in PHP web server can be run on any computer that has PHP installed.

Unzip it and save it on your desktop- Fprojectsmy-php-websitephp. But its still only intended for development environment and testing. You could only run one single HTTPS website on a single port on the server except in certain circumstances.

It doesnt support SSL encryption. Use this spin box to specify the port on which the PHP built-in web server runs. The web server runs only one single-threaded process so PHP applications will stall if a request is blocked.

Get that working first before tackling the client certificates. By default this port is set to port 80. It is not designed to be used on public networks.

PhpStorm has a built-in web server that can be used to preview and debug your application. How to run the PHP built-in web server. You can set the port number to any other value starting with 1024 and higher.

Now press type cmd and press enter to open your command prompt. One of the cooler features of the new PHP 54 release is a built-in web server designed specifically for development and testing. Download PHP for Windows.

Read:  How To Create Vps On Dedicated Server

Having said that developers who experienced any of web application frameworks of other scripting languages such as Ruby on Rails and Django may well find it cumbersome to set up httpdconf just to use it within a development environment as those are most likely accompanied by a tiny web server that can be launched with a simple command line. It provides support of the protocol and allows you to extend capabilities by subclassing. Its for plain HTTP requests.

Now navigate to your websites root folder using this command- cd fprojectsmy-php-website. In this video well be learning how to use PHPs built in web server to get up and running as fast as possible when were making our PHP appsGo to httpsh. This server is always running and does not require any manual configuration.

To use a PHP built-in web server go to the root directory of your project and run this simple command on a terminal. See the manual section on the built-in webserver shim. As of PHP 540 the CLI SAPI provides a built-in web server.

This server is distributed as a bundle so you must first install and enable the server bundle. By default host is set to localhost because the built-in server is located on your machine. Until some years ago there was a rule one port one certificate.

If you want SSL to run over it try a stunnel wrapper.

The Drupal Console Cheat Sheet A Quick Reference Guide Web Developer Php Drupal Symfony Silex Drupal Coder Cheating

Udemy 100 Free Launch A Lamp Stack And Install WordPress On Aws Mysql Php Udemy Free Learning

Read:  How To Get Web Server Space

Drag Drop Email Builder By Persefone It Drag Drop Email Editor Emaileditor By Persefone Is A Dr Email Editor Project Management Tools Custom Email Template

Built In Web Server Phpstorm

Is It Still Relevant To Build Websites With Php In 2020 2021

Comparison Or Ternary Operators Top10 Tips To Improve Your Php Based Custom Web Application Https Php Tutorial Web Development Design Web Development

Hosting Php Application To Send Email Of Esp32 Or Esp8266 Bme280 Sensor Readings In 2021 Router Access Point Arduino Router

Php Mysql Server Side Web Development By Jon Duckett Https Www Amazon Com Dp 1119149223 Ref Cm Sw R Pi Dp Web Development Web Design Quotes Computer Books

High Risk Vulnerabilities In Php Web Applications By Munish Walia Medium

Infographic On Evolution Of Php Php F1 To Php 7 3 By Clarion Technologies

Important Web Hosting Considerations Choosing The Best Web Hosting For Online Business Web Design Tips Website Hosting Blog Hosting Blog Hosting Sites

10 Top Websites To Download Free Php Scripts Script Server Side Scripting Top Websites

Getting Started With Web Application Using Php Mysql Tutorials

Themeqx Advanced Php Laravel Classified Ads Cms Https Www Laravel Vuejs Com Themeqx Advanced Php Laravel Classified Ads Classified Ads Php Instagram Shop

Answer To What S New In Laravel 5 8 By Dinesh Suthar Answers Whats New Beginners

Which Company Is Best For Laravel Web Development In Usa Development Web Development Application Development

Https Decodeweb In How Do I Deploy Laravel Project From Git To Shared Hosting Server Mysql Hosting Trending Memes

Php Server On Local Machine Stack Overflow

You May Also Like